Manama, Mohammed bin Thamer Al Kaabi, the Minister of Transportation and Telecommunications, met with Khalid bin Baijan Al Osaimi, the CEO of STC Bahrain. The minister highlighted the role of telecommunications companies in advancing digital development in Bahrain. He commended the contributions of STC Bahrain in this area. Al Kaabi expressed full support for initiatives that advance the information and communication technology (ICT) sector and digital economy, emphasising their importance for enhancing service quality and accessibility for citizens and residents. STC CEO expressed thanks to the minister for his ongoing support for the ICT sector in Bahrain. He emphasised STC Bahrain's dedication to delivering top-notch services and supporting the objectives of Bahrain's Economic Vision 2030. Source: Bahrain News Agency
